Jammu and Kashmir cricket team Reach First-Ever Ranji Trophy 2025–26 Final; Auqib Nabi Eyes Big Show vs Karnataka

Jammu and Kashmir have scripted history by reaching the final of the Ranji Trophy 2025–26 for the first time ever. The landmark achievement has sparked celebrations back home, but fast bowler Auqib Nabi insists he is staying focused on the task ahead.

“I am just focusing on the present. I’m not paying attention to outside noise. I will try to get more wickets in the final and stick to the process that has worked for me so far,” Nabi told PTI, adding that expectations do not distract him.

The pacer, who is the second-highest wicket-taker this season, said the team’s confidence stems from their performances in away conditions. J&K have registered impressive wins at Delhi, Bengal and Madhya Pradesh’s home grounds en route to the final.

“We’ve worked hard for years for this moment. The final is a big game, but everyone is positive. Winning at opponents’ home grounds has given us a big boost,” he said.

Nabi emphasised the importance of discipline and adaptability against Karnataka in the summit clash. “No matter the pitch or conditions, I need to bowl in the same channel outside the off-stump. That’s what brought me wickets this season. At the same time, adapting quickly will be key,” he noted.

He also credited head coach Ajay Sharma and bowling coach P Krishnakumar for transforming the team’s mindset and performance. “Having a bowling coach over the last few years has made a drastic difference. We now get regular feedback, which has helped us improve as a unit,” Nabi said.

Jammu and Kashmir will face Karnataka cricket team in the Ranji Trophy final starting February 24 at the KSCA Hubli Cricket Ground in Hubli.

With momentum on their side and belief running high, J&K now stand one step away from completing a fairytale campaign.
